PURPOSE: Volunteers will support the Como Campus Interpretive Program in enriching the visitor experience by creating a warm and welcoming atmosphere while sharing information about Como’s plants and animals. DUTIES: Volunteers will: Share connections between plants, animals, and humans through props, stories and hands-on activities. Promote the interests of animal and plant conservation and the importance of bio-diversity. Inform visitors about fascinating animal and plant adaptations that help them survive. Greet and assist visitors with general information about the facilities. Monitor visitor activities in the facilities’ buildings and on the grounds. Assist with program development, training, and evaluation as requested. Description
For over 100 years, Marjorie McNeely Conservatory and Como Zoo in Saint Paul, Minnesota has charmed, educated and entertained millions of children and adults while fostering an appreciation of the natural world, helping to make Saint Paul the Most Livable City in America. Como Park Zoo and Conservatory welcomes 1.7 million visitors from around the world - the second biggest tourist attraction in Minnesota. The Como Park Zoo and Conservatory is open 365 days; 10am-6pm from April-September and 10am-4pm from October -March . Admission to both the Como Zoo and Marjorie McNeely Conservatory is always free and a voluntary donation is appreciated.
